We are so excited about the amazing progress with the Bamboo project in Putumayo with the Cofan, El Diviso indigenous community!!! February 2025: six members of the community attend a training with @ekawa_bamboolab in Medellin! May 2025: build bamboo curing & processing facility under the guidance of bamboo specialist and professor from University of Costa Rica, Maik August 2025: construction of bamboo workshop/ carpentry for the community… in preparation for the construction of their new community house! Everyone is so excited! Thank you @jaimepenastudio for your architectural design contribution! It is so amazing to see these beautiful structures come to life! Bamboo is an abundant resource in the area and grows much faster than trees! The indigenous of el Diviso are learning how to work with Bamboo and we are all so excited for the many opportunities and possibilities that are opening up for them as a source to build their own structures and as a possibility for economy!

This moment holds so much meaning. I’m standing surrounded by the first 244 pieces of bamboo cured by the Cofán community of El Diviso. Each one represents a shift. A confirmation that transformation is possible when people take change into their own hands. What began as a learning process became a realization. Everything they need is already in their land. From learning how to cut and cure bamboo, to processing it to the right size, to shaping it into their first creation together, the community workshop. This was not easy work. It took patience, trust, and consistency. And it all happened in just six months. Six months ago this was only a vision. Today it stands as proof. Can you imagine one year from now? This is Taita Otoniel one of the spiritual leaders of the CofĂĄn community of El Diviso. He comes from an unbroken lineage of healers and wisdom keepers who have safeguarded these lands, waters, and medicines for generations. Their knowledge is not something learned from books. It is lived, transmitted, and embodied through ceremony, relationship, and devotion to life. Today, many in the modern world are searching for healing, balance, and harmony. What they are longing for has been preserved here for centuries. Yet these ancient lineages are at risk. The exploitation of their territory is forcing younger generations to leave in search of opportunity. When youth are pushed into cities, the transmission of millenary wisdom breaks. And when the guardians leave the land, it becomes vulnerable to oil, mining, and illicit exploitation. TerraKeepers is acting now. By supporting families directly and creating real opportunities rooted in the land, we help ensure these lineages continue and these territories remain protected. This is about preserving wisdom. Protecting the Earth. And honoring those who have been doing so long before us.
